Fetterman: Trump has ‘zero leverage’
over lame-duck GOP senators

Original Article

Posted By: Mercedes44, 8/1/2026 5:53:05 PM

Sen. John Fetterman (D-Pa.) pointed to weaknesses in President Trump’s influence in Congress amid opposition from three outgoing Republican senators to the president’s nomination of acting Attorney General Todd Blanche to a permanent role overseeing the Department of Justice (DOJ). Sens. Thom Tillis (N.C.), Bill Cassidy (La.) and John Cornyn (Texas) have all expressed skepticism about Blanche’s nomination amid questions about the status of a controversial “anti-weaponization fund” created under his watch.

Declining attendance, fewer priests driving
Catholic parish closures, consolidations
across U.S.
20 replies
Posted by Beardo 8/1/2026 6:23:24 AM Post Reply
Nearly one in five Americans identifies as Catholic, yet many dioceses across the country have closed or consolidated parishes this year due to declining mass attendance, fewer people taking priestly vocations and rising maintenance costs. The most intense reductions are occurring primarily in the Midwest and Northeast, specifically in Iowa, Illinois, Indiana, Michigan, Minnesota, Missouri, Pennsylvania and Rhode Island.
